Title:

IT Project Manager - Pharmaceutical

Location:

On-site, Bloomington, IN

Client Industry:

Pharmaceutical Manufacturing/Life Sciences

Compensation:

$50 - $65/hr.

We have partnered with our client in their search for a high-visibility, on-site IT Project Manager role overseeing the full project life-cycle for multiple technology initiatives in a regulated pharmaceutical manufacturing environment. You will drive schedules, budgets, resources, vendors, and quality-using Smartsheet and standard PM methodologies-while acting as the primary communication hub between IT, business stakeholders, and third-party partners.

Responsibilities

Own end-to-end delivery for concurrent IT infrastructure, application, and compliance projects (initiation through closeout) Build and maintain integrated project schedules, RAID logs, resource plans, and executive dashboards in Smartsheet Facilitate daily stand-ups, status reviews, and senior-level steering committees; publish concise updates and action items Track project budgets, purchase orders, vendor SOWs, and invoices; reconcile actuals vs. forecast and report variances Coordinate cross-functional teams (IT, Quality, Manufacturing, Validation, Finance, external vendors) to remove blockers and meet milestones Enforce GxP compliance, CSV, and data-integrity standards throughout project activities Manage change control, risk mitigation, and issue escalation, ensuring timely resolution and documentation Capture lessons learned and implement continuous-improvement practices across the PMO

Skills Required

Expert-level Smartsheet plus solid MS Project/Excel/PowerPoint skills An understanding of GxP, 21 CFR Part 11, computerized-system validation, and quality-by-design principles Strong financial acumen: budget creation, cost tracking, invoice approval, and vendor management Influential leadership and meeting-facilitation abilities; comfortable presenting to VPs/C-suite Working knowledge of SDLC, Agile/Scrum, and hybrid methodologies; experience with Jira or Azure DevOps a plus Superior documentation, risk management, and analytical problem-solving skills

Education & Work

Experience

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Computer Science, Engineering, or related field (Master's or MBA a plus) 4 - 5+ years overall IT experience with 3+ years dedicated project-management responsibility in a regulated pharma/biotech setting
